#584377 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#584377 is composed of 34.5% red, 26.3%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.1% cyan, 43.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 264.2 degrees, a saturation of 28% and a lightness of 36.5%. #584377 color hex could be obtained by blending #b086ee with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#584377 color description : Mostly desaturated dark violet.
#584377 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#584377 has RGB values of R:88, G:67,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 5784439.

Shades and Tints of #584377
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040306 is the darkest color, while #faf9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#584377
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5862 is the less saturated color, while #4c03b7 is the most saturated one.
